which describes amaras mistake?\nshe should have drawn a concave lens instead of a convex lens.\nshe should have drawn the image right - side up instead of upside down.\nray 2 should cross through the focal point on the right side of the lens.\nray 3 should point at a downward angle after passing through the lens.

Answer

Explanation:

Step1: Recall ray - tracing rules for convex lens

For a convex lens, a ray parallel to the principal axis (ray 2) passes through the focal point on the other side of the lens. In the given diagram, ray 2 is drawn incorrectly as it does not pass through the focal point on the right - hand side of the lens.

Step2: Analyze other options

A convex lens is correctly chosen as per the problem context, so the first option is wrong. For a real image formed by a convex lens, the image is inverted, so the second option is wrong. Ray 3 which passes through the optical center of the lens should go straight without changing direction, so the fourth option is wrong.

Answer:

Ray 2 should cross through the focal point on the right side of the lens.
